Cleveland Clinic's Department of Thoracic Surgery
The surgeons within Cleveland Clinic's Department of Thoracic Surgery are leaders in the surgical treatment of diseases of the lung and esophagus, including lung cancer,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), lung failure, esophageal cancer, Barrett's esophagus, achalasia, and hyperhidrosis.Our comprehensive program, which is part of the Department of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ery, serves as a national referral center, offering cutting edge screening techniques to the latest minimally invasive surgical procedures.
Multidisciplinary clinics are available for swallowing disorders, airway disease, lung failure and lung cancer.
